TitleDynamics of Germinosome Formation Interactions between GerD and Germinant Receptor Subunits in Bacillus cereus Spores
DescriptionSpores of the bacterium Bacillus cereus can cause disease in humans due to contamination of raw materials for food manufacturing. These dormant, resistant spores can survive for years in the environment, but can germinate and grow when their surroundings become suitable, and spore germination proteins play an important role in the decision to germinate. The dataset attached describes the quantification of the fluorophores of the expressed fusion proteins by label free mass spectrometry.
